We are looking for a Data Center Engineering Operations Technician to join our expanding Infrastructure Operations team. A Data Center Engineering Operations Technician role is a hands-on electrical and mechanical equipment troubleshooting and operation responder. If you like to apply your electrical and mechanical skills to solve problems, we’d like to meet you. Your work will help to maintain one of the world's largest information system infrastructures.
Key job responsibilities
SAFETY
Follow and maintain the highest safety standards and diligently encourage a world-class safety culture. As a facility owner team, ensure remediation of safety risks/issues in conjunction with other teams. Own the safety initiatives and projects to foster strong safety culture.
ENGINEERING & FACILITY OPERATIONS AND MAINTENANCE
- Operational experience and familiarity with electrical and mechanical equipment, including Uninterruptable Power Supplies (UPS’s), Switchgear, Circuit Breakers, Automatic Transfer Switches (ATS's), Diesel Generators, Chillers, Heating Ventilation Air Conditioning (HVAC), Exhaust Fans, Variable Frequency Drives (VFD's), and Transformers.
- Troubleshoot events within internal Service Level Agreements (SLA’s).
- Take daily operational readings of all mechanical and electrical equipment through routine rounds/log-taking (temperatures, voltages, currents, etc.).
- Supervise contractors who perform servicing or preventive maintenance.
- Manual handling and lifting of equipment may be required (weight limits in accordance with health & safety regulations).
- Ability to work shifts.

Minimum Requirements
- Knowledge of safe electrical practices according to guidelines set by relevant electrical safety supervisory bodies (e.g., ECSSAI and RECI in Ireland).
- Professional Electrical or Mechanical Certification (National Craft Certificate (NCC), Registered Electrical Contractor (REC) or equivalent) or formal equivalent relevant qualification.
- Knowledge of key electrical competencies and theory.
- Experience with Microsoft Office products and applications.
